On 12/9/24 08:35, Daniel P. Berrangé wrote:
> QEMU takes contributions via the mailing list, so while you can edit a
> file on gitlab and then switch to the terminal to send a patch, the
> wording 'Edit on GitLab' strongly suggests we take merge requests.
>
> Switching back to "View page source" is a more agnostic term that does
> not imply a particular contribution approach, that we had used in QEMU
> before:
